TUSI seeks maximum total returns by investing in a diversified portfolio of US fixed income securities, which may include US treasurys, government securities, corporate bonds, cash equivalents, and with an emphasis on structured products (i.e., MBS, commercial MBS, ABS, and CLOs). The portfolio mainly consists of investment grade securities, but may allocate up to 15% of the portfolio in high-yield securities. The fund may invest in debt of any maturity but seeks to maintain an effective fund duration of one year or less. In selecting components for the fund, the portfolio manager will invest in securities believed to be attractively priced relative to the market or to similar instruments. The fund may engage in frequent and active trading of securities.
